ABLE- Advanced Bodyweight Leverage Equipment

ABLE - Advanced Bodyweight Leverage Equipment. The best push up stands and ab roller in one! ABLE hardware is designed for instability training, challenging chest exercises, rotating push ups, Ab and core workouts at home or at the gym.

319 views
0 faves
0 comments
Uploaded on April 7, 2020